Hill stations in India offer great relief to people from the tropical sun. Once these places were built as summer resorts but with the passage of time hill stations in India have become a great attraction throughout the year. Even during the winter months when temperature dip far below freezing point, tourists flock to these hill stations and enjoy the snow and the chilling environment.
